Langshaw, QLD 4570

Part of: Gympie Council No data available

The size of Langshaw is approximately 41.8 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 2.4% of total area. The population of Langshaw in 2016 was 169 people. By 2021 the population was 167 showing a population decline of 1.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Langshaw is 60-69 years. Households in Langshaw are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Langshaw work in a managers occupation.In 2021, 80.30% of the homes in Langshaw were owner-occupied compared with 75.00% in 2016. (source: Australian Bureau of Statistics)
